About

Usk sits on the River Usk as a compact market town with a long history. A Norman motte and the line of the old castle earthworks lie close to the river, and a stone bridge links the town to the meadows on the opposite bank. Narrow streets contain independent shops, a market tradition and a handful of listed buildings that reflect Georgian rebuilding alongside older timber frames. Each summer the Usk agricultural show takes place on the town’s outskirts, bringing livestock, trade stands and local producers together on the river plain.

Goytre and Llangybi Fawr are the surrounding parishes of lanes, farms and small woodlands that feed into the town. Villages cluster around their parish churches and village greens, with footpaths and bridleways connecting fields and hedgerows to the riverside walks at Usk. The pattern of small fields, grazing meadows and occasional woodland blocks gives way to wider views across the Usk valley, and pastoral land use remains the dominant feature of this part of Monmouthshire.

Area overview

On average Usk, Goytre & Llangybi Fawr has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 29 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 5.7%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Usk, Goytre & Llangybi Fawr is £50,682 per year. Usk, Goytre & Llangybi Fawr is home to around 8,313 people, with a population density of about 63.4 per km2.

Property prices in Usk, Goytre & Llangybi Fawr

Based on 69 recent sales, the median property price is £325,000 in Usk, Goytre & Llangybi Fawr area, with individual transactions ranging from £85,000 up to £757,500.
